When do retail non-compete agreements help versus hurt market competition?
Camilla Schneier scraped thousands of documents from Chicago's county recorder office and found something unexpected about exclusive dealing contracts in real estate.
These agreements - where retailers tell landlords "don't rent to my competitors" - were overall pro-competitive in Chicago. But Camilla's framework examines when they might flip to anti-competitive.
Key insights:
• Contracts are highly heterogeneous and very local in scope
• Effects depend entirely on context - "aren't always good at every point"
• Different retailers block completely different competitor types
